The document describes a training series on autism spectrum disorders consisting of 11 modules that cover topics such as the characteristics and signs of autism, cognition and learning in autism, communication challenges, behavior issues, functional behavior assessment, and teaching play skills to children with autism. The specific section summarized discusses how play skills need to be directly taught to children with autism as they may not learn them automatically, and outlines strategies for increasing play skills such as adapting activities to interests and abilities, breaking skills into steps, using visual and physical prompts, providing choices, and initially practicing with an adult before peers.
